Zori Balayan turned 90: the famous surgeon's son shared exclusive details from the anniversary. PHOTO


"Iravunk"writes:

ZORI BALAYAN, a prominent writer, publicist, and a leader of the Artsakh liberation struggle, has turned 90."Iravunk"has learned exclusive details about how the intellectual celebrated his anniversary from his son, a famous surgeonHAYK BALAYAN:

— Mr. Balayan, how did you celebrate your father's anniversary?

— Due to the difficult situation in our country and his health problems, we did not celebrate it with great pomp in some restaurant, but at home. But the anniversary was spent in a very warm, joyful atmosphere, with family members and grandchildren.

— Who did the 90-year-old Balayan receive congratulations from?

— There was a barrage of calls from both Armenia and different parts of the world. He received congratulations from pen pals, ideological sympathizers, and simply from his well-wishers. I was the one who constantly answered the phone calls, turned on the speakerphone so that he could hear. He received a congratulatory letter from the Writers' Union, even Baroness Caroline Cox sent her best wishes. Many people visited during the day to see him for at least 5-10 minutes, shake his hand and congratulate him.

— And how is Mr. Balayan's health now?

— May it stay like this, thank God. The important thing is that he be with us. In fact, we were all more happy on the occasion of the anniversary, because starting from his 50th birthday, we were always worried about our father's health. He underwent two surgeries, went through the difficult years of Artsakh. He had an inexplicable regimen, we were always afraid that something would happen to him. But, thank God, we are celebrating his 90th birthday.
